ABC’s LOST (yep, we’re at the “Lost Remote seeks LOST Google bait” again) is going to be simulcast around the globe at the same time. That means it will be on at 5am in Great Britain. It will also be on simultaneously in Italy, Spain, Portugal, Israel, Turkey and Canada, according to The Guardian. SKY1, which runs the show in the UK, will also run the finale at its traditional time slot. This makes too much sense – so why won’t we see this in the US?
